WebJan 15, 2024 · The CSP header stops this happening and blocks this script if the PDF is opened within the browser. If the PDF file is saved to the computer and then opened in the Adobe PDF file viewer, this specific CSP protection is no longer enabled. (Other mitigators may be present in the Adobe program). WebOct 17, 2024 · Security response headers. Security response headers are HTTP headers that web servers/applications can set when returning data to web clients. They are used to communicate security policy settings for a web browser that is interacting with the web site.
